CourseDetails

โ€ข Introduction to Biomass-Based Composites: Understanding the basics of biomass-based composites, their importance, and applications.
โ€ข Types of Biomass Feedstocks: Exploring various biomass feedstocks like lignocellulosic biomass, agricultural residues, and energy crops.
โ€ข Biomass Processing Techniques: Examining methods for biomass pre-treatment, size reduction, and purification.
โ€ข Polymer Matrices: Investigating different types of thermoplastic and thermosetting polymers used in biomass-based composites.
โ€ข Reinforcement Fibers: Discussing natural fibers and their properties, as well as their role in biomass-based composites.
โ€ข Manufacturing Technologies: Reviewing various manufacturing techniques like injection molding, compression molding, and extrusion.
โ€ข Mechanical and Thermal Properties: Analyzing the mechanical and thermal properties of biomass-based composites and their performance.
โ€ข Sustainability and Life Cycle Assessment: Evaluating the environmental and economic aspects of biomass-based composites.
โ€ข Market Trends and Future Prospects: Exploring the current market trends and future prospects in biomass-based composites.
